Regarding the wolf teeth, we have them removed routinely and/or when
necessary. There is usually very little bleeding (the teeth aren't that
big) and even anesthetic is not always necessary. We did our yearling
when he was gelded and he took the whole thing like a champ. It
definitely helps with problems from the bit.
For the person wanting Driving tapes, I would recommend "Holding the
Reins" with John Parker and Paul Heiny, an informative and enjoyable
"basic" tape, and also Lynn Palmer's "Pleasure Driving" which has
excellent material on training.
